The Practical Significance of Structured Information in Public Security Analysis

In the domain of public security and law enforcement, the volume of available data has grown exponentially with the rise of digital communications, social platforms, and open sources. Raw information—ranging from social media posts and news articles to multimedia content—often arrives in unstructured formats that are difficult to process efficiently. Transforming this raw material into structured information represents a fundamental shift in intelligence operations, enabling faster threat detection, more accurate pattern recognition, and evidence-based decision-making. Knowlesys Intelligence System (KIS), as a comprehensive OSINT platform, exemplifies how structured approaches to data handling deliver tangible operational advantages for law enforcement agencies and intelligence departments.

Understanding Structured Information in the Context of Public Security

Structured information refers to data that has been organized, categorized, and enriched with metadata, making it searchable, comparable, and analyzable through automated tools. Unlike unstructured data—such as free-text posts, videos, or images—structured data fits into defined schemas with fields like timestamps, geolocations, account attributes, sentiment scores, propagation metrics, and entity relationships. This organization is essential in public security analysis, where timely insights can prevent escalation of risks, support investigations, and inform resource allocation.

The transition from raw open-source data to structured intelligence removes noise, highlights correlations, and supports scalable analysis across massive datasets. In practice, structured information enables law enforcement to move beyond manual review toward systematic, proactive intelligence workflows.

Deeper Intelligence Analysis and Insight Generation

Analysis gains depth when data is structured. KIS provides nine analytical dimensions, including thematic parsing, sentiment evaluation, account profiling, false account detection, influence assessment, propagation path tracing, geographic mapping, facial recognition, and multimedia sourcing. By organizing data into these structured layers, analysts can visualize networks, identify key nodes, and uncover behavioral patterns that would remain hidden in raw formats. Knowledge graphs and heat maps derived from structured elements accelerate investigations and reveal hidden linkages among entities.
